Comprehending Freezer Efficiency
When assessing the effectiveness of a freezer, a number of elements come into play:
Energy Consumption: Measured in kilowatt-hours (kWh), this indicates how much energy the freezer uses with time.Capability: The quantity of storage space available, generally measured in cubic feet.Temperature level Control: The capability to preserve consistent temperature levels in various conditions.Energy Star Certification: Indicates that the device satisfies particular energy effectiveness guidelines set by the US Environmental Protection Agency.Effectiveness Ratings
It's necessary to recognize efficiency scores before buying a freezer. Energy-efficient designs frequently feature the Energy Star label, which symbolizes that they use considerably less energy than basic designs.

When picking a freezer, understanding the different types offered helps in making an informed choice. Here are the two primary categories:
1. Chest FreezerPros: Excellent energy performance, holds cold air much better when opened, sufficient storage area, much better for long-lasting storage.Cons: Takes up more flooring space, more difficult to arrange, requires flexing down.2. Upright FreezerPros: Easier to organize, smaller sized footprint, features racks for much better ease of access.Cons: Less energy-efficient compared to chest freezers, cold air gets away more easily when opened.Table: Comparison of Freezer TypesFunctionChest FreezerUpright FreezerEnergy EfficiencyHighModerateEase of accessNeeds flexingSimpler gain access to with shelvesAreaTakes more flooring areaCompact footprintTemperature StabilityExceptionalGood, but less steadyFunctions to Consider

The ideal size typically depends upon family size and use. Usually, assign about 1.5 to 2 cubic feet of freezer area per person in the household.
How can I make the most of the performance of my freezer?Keep a consistent temperature in between -10 ° F and 0 ° F. Keep the freezer full, as food assists preserve the cold (use ice packs if necessary).Avoid leaving the door open for prolonged periods.How typically should I defrost my freezer?
Frost accumulation can reduce performance. Manual defrost freezers need to be defrosted when frost goes beyond 1/4 inch.
